How they compare
Portugal currently reports 2.2% against 1.7% in Oman, a difference of 0.5%.
That makes Portugal's figure about 1.3 times Oman's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Portugal ahead.
Oman ranks 124th and Portugal ranks 121st of 210 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Oman averaged higher in 1 and Portugal in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Oman | Portugal |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 18.1% | 29.2% | 11.1% | Portugal |
| 2000s | 9.9% | 14.6% | 4.6% | Portugal |
| 2010s | 2.6% | 3.2% | 0.6% | Portugal |
| 2020s | 2.7% | 2.5% | 0.2% | Oman |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The share of electricity production from oil sources of total electricity production. Sources of electricity refer to the inputs used to generate electricity. Oil refers to crude oil and petroleum products.
